Symone Abbott

Professional Experience

  • Played in 18 matches (12 starts) and 56 sets for the Grand Rapids Rise in the inaugural 2024 Pro Volleyball Federation season, recording 131 kills (.170), 126 digs, 11 blocks, seven assists, and five aces. Notched two double-doubles in back-to-back matches against Omaha (2/12) and Atlanta (2/18). Season-high 17 kills at San Diego (2/23). Scored double figures in points five times with a personal best of 18 points against Atlanta (2/18) and San Diego (2/23). Produced two matches hitting .400 or better (minimum 10 attack attempts), including a .500 hitting percentage (eight kills and one error on 14 swings) in a five-set win over Omaha (5/12).
  • Finished in second place in the Greek Cup and won the Nomikeia tournament in 2021-22 with AO Thiras.
  • Collected a bronze medal at the 2020-21 Pan-American Cup.
  • In 2018-19, named Best Outside Hitter in the French Cup en route to winning the French Cup with Saint-Raphael Var.
  • Made pro debut in 2017 with Liu Jo Nordmeccania Modena in Italy.

College Experience

  • Competed at Northwestern University from 2014-17, totaling 1,613 kills, and a hitting percentage of .210.
  • As a senior in 2017, paced the Big Ten with 10.72 attacks per set, ranked third with four kills per set and fourth with 4.49 points per set.
  • Named a 2017 AVCA All-American Honorable Mention, AVCA All-Region First Team, and a First-Team All-Big Ten member.
  • As a junior in 2016, 11.96 attacks per set ranked 13th nationally and 4.10 kills per set placed fourth in the Big Ten, 41st nationally, and were the sixth-best mark in school history.
  • In 2016, 459 kills ranked third in Northwestern history and 1,339 total attacks were the second-most ever by a Wildcat junior (trailing only Stephania Holthus’ mark of 1,350).
  • Ranked second among Big Ten freshmen with 3.19 kills per set in 2014 and placed third among conference freshmen with 3.37 points per set.
